Ticket: PWR-214 — Expired service credential blocking reset-flow work

The Keyloft token used by the Fernhollow password-reset revamp expired last night, so the staging email dispatcher is rejecting all reset requests. A replacement has been provisioned with the same scopes. Update your local `.env` and restart the worker before resuming testing. The new key is below.

service key, tadup-tahog: zpat7_wB1tnEL

### Step 4: Cut over the alert fan-out

For this week's sync: migrate the Stormline weather-alert fan-out from the legacy push daemon to the Cloudmere queue workers. Alerts are deduplicated by region key, so double-delivery during the overlap window is expected and safe. Keep the legacy daemon draining for 24 hours before decommission. Severity-critical alerts bypass batching entirely; verify that path first in staging. Once cutover begins, the workers must run with the following configuration.

service settings:
[casax]
port = 6379
team = rusir
host = casax.zemvarhq.corp
region = outer-4
access_code = ac_9808ce
timeout_ms = 1500

## Deployment

Graphlet, our dependency graph visualizer, ships as a single container built by the Tindervale CI pipeline. The release manager promotes the image from staging to production after the smoke suite passes; no manual migration steps are required since Graphlet reads its edge data from the Corville metadata store at boot. Rollbacks are done by re-tagging the previous image. Before promoting, verify the environment matches the expected settings. The current production configuration values are listed below.

config for fahog-hahip:
ZORWYN_HOST=zorwyn.lumicsys.internal
ZORWYN_PORT=9200

Internal Memo — Franchise Agreement, Board Distribution

Grovelane Coffeeworks has finalized terms for its first franchise agreement, covering three outlets in the Castermouth region. The operator assumes fit-out costs; royalties are set at the standard tier with a two-year review clause. Legal has cleared the draft for signature next month. Context on how this fits our expansion plans follows below.

board note of kafog-bajep: Briathek Partners is in early talks to buy Aldaelek Group for about $47.1 million. The Ulaath launch date is September 4, and nothing goes to the press before then.